Come and see innovative concepts!

Several demonstrators on the booth will give visitors the opportunity to discover some of the recent innovations made by the CEA at INES and its partners:

High efficiency PV modules:

- The first one made with a qualified transparent backsheet, meeting the requirements of cost, performance and durability

- The second, which has a low carbon footprint with recycled glass and Lin composite bascksheet offering a 10% improvement in LCA

Lightweight, low carbon footprint module concepts:

- One using an innovative flax/basalt composite backsheet, achieving a reduction of 70 kgCO2/kWp

- and one demonstrating the development of a biosourced thermoplastic polymer front sheet

A self-consumption photovoltaic system concept to power WIFI antennas in isolated locations.

An on-site audit solution for the diagnosis of photovoltaic power plants by means of I-V curves

 

Come and meet INES and partners!

2CA - a developer, designer and manufacturer of specific French photovoltaic systems, through its Opérasol® brand - 2CA offers the study, the production from prototype to series of PV modules as well as their system integration

CEA at INES - Global leader in R&D for advanced photovoltaic technologies, their integration into electrical systems and intelligent energy management - brings expertise to the industry, from proof of concept to technology transfer.

CERTISOLIS - French Independent Photovoltaic Laboratory - provides tests and conformity certificates to IEC 61215 & 61730 and expertise on site of solar power plants with his mobile laboratory. The company delivers as well carbon foot prints for PV modules and AQPV accreditation.

ITE INES.2S, launched in 2019, is an energy transition institute (ITE).

Carried by the CEA, its mission is to develop in France an industrial sector of the integration of photovoltaic solar energy, in support of the law of Multiannual Programming of Energy.

ECM Greentech - equipment supplier for renewable energy production (PV) and energy storage (lithium-ion batteries, hydrogen) - deliver turnkey plant solutions in the field of renewable energies & semiconductor covering the entire value chain. It is also specialized in advanced crystal growth.

Photowatt - pioneer in the solar energy industry for more than 40 years – is today a leader in the production of low carbon ingots, wafers and high efficiency photovoltaic modules.

Roctool - specialists in mold heating and cooling technologies for plastics and composites -develops with CEA at INES new ways for combining the use of bio-based and recyclable materials, with a high-performance manufacturing technology.

Steadysun - solar energy & weather forecasting, cloud & atmospheric observation, services and consulting in solar energy and electrical systems.  - offers products and services to foster the integration of solar energy into electrical systems, while reducing the risks and the costs associated with weather variability.
